A circle is a curve sketched out by a point moving in a plane so that its distance from a given point is constant; alternatively, it is the shape formed by all points in a plane that are at a set distance from a given point, the center.
The measure of arc EAB is 180°, this is because EB is the diameter of the circle. Also, the measure of ∠BOC is 40°. Therefore, the measure of the arc EBC can be written as,
arc EBC = 180° + 40° = 220°
Hence, the measure of Arc EBC is 220°.
